October/November 2024 Exam Analysis
The 9700 Winter 2024 series maintained the syllabus's reputation for high-level conceptual demands and precise marking requirements. Across the paper types, examiners thoroughly assessed candidates' ability to link micro-scale structures with macro-level physiological outcomes, particularly in plant physiology, bioenergetics, and ecological mechanics.
Where the Marks Are Won or Lost
A significant portion of marks in the structured papers relied heavily on spatial clarity and logical progression. In Paper 23, explaining the function of specialised gut epithelial cells required students to link organelles directly to cellular roles—specifically identifying RER and Golgi bodies in mucin/mucus secretion. Conversely, many students lost marks by confusing microvilli with cilia. In Paper 43, the mechanism of stomatal opening and the differences in responses between Mimosa pudica and Venus flytraps demanded sequential accuracy, from active proton pumping to turgor changes.
Examiner Pitfalls & Mathematical Precision
Practical and mathematical applications proved to be major deciders. Candidates often struggled with the calculation of Simpson's Index of Diversity and the Lincoln Index, frequently due to rounding intermediate values too early in the steps. Furthermore, incomplete genetic diagrams—such as omitting gametes or failing to explicitly pair phenotypes with genotypes—remained a prominent pitfall in the inheritance and selection questions.
Preparation & Revision Strategy
To score highly, candidates must transition away from rote memorisation toward dynamic system pathways. Focus on practicing multi-step cell signalling pathways, standardising experimental variables (especially colorimeter calibrations and serial dilutions), and memorising specific command word actions. When asked to 'compare and contrast', ensure you provide direct, matched comparisons rather than isolated descriptions of each subject.
